The digital artwork "Eternal Love" shows a porcelain grave cross, graceful and fragile, decorated with delicate roses in soft shades of pink and green leaves. The cross stands on a marble grave in the idyllic artist village of Saint Paul de Vence, famous for its rich artistic history and picturesque surroundings. The image is almost photographic in quality, with a razor-sharp rendering of details: the fine cracks in the porcelain, the subtle shadows of the rose petals, and the small twigs lying on the grave.
The composition plays with contrasts: the hardness of the cross versus the softness of the flowers; the life of nature versus the stillness of death. The sunlight falls filtered through tall cypress trees and makes glints appear on the cross, making the colours feel warm and nostalgic. Full attention is drawn to the cross and roses, as a symbol of enduring love and remembrance.
Despite the subdued composition, the work exudes emotional depth. It raises questions about impermanence, connection and the way love persists even after death. The almost photographic style makes the viewer feel like a silent witness, as if he or she were pausing for a moment themselves at this intimate, hushed moment in the famous village where art and life converge. The work invites reflection and remembrance.
